is anyone having issues with their overdrive? mine takes forever to connect then has trouble maintaining a 4G signal.

I dont mind that it switches back to 3G, but what am I paying for then?

Also, it spontaneously turns itself off on occasion. Does anyone else have this happen as well?

I have a similar problem. If I was not moving, it would stay with 4G just fine. But I use mine when commuting by light rail and bus. I found that it spent more time switching between the two bands than it did actually providing me with access. I had to lock it to 3G just to stay connected when commuting.
